Fable: TLC - Modding Guide (YouTube Playlist):    • Fable: TLC - Modding Guide   In this video, I will be demonstrating how to make a "Backup" of your Game Data. This can be done by simply copying the game files (which can be found in the location that you installed it at) and pasting those same files somewhere else on your computer's hard drive. Backing up your game files is great for keeping yourself a fresh copy of the game that you know has no modifications to it, just in case you ever make a mistake when modifying the game files and want to revert back to a vanilla version of the game. This process will allow you to delete your current version of the game and replace it with the "backup version" whenever you find it necessary to do so. If you don't make a backup of your game files, then you are forced to uninstall the game and completely reinstall the entire thing all over again... and you have to do this EVERY time that you make one single mistake. By backing up your game, you will be saving yourself a lot of time in the long run. If you have any questions about the video, then feel free to let me know in the comments below and I will do my best to help you! - ✅ - - How To Back-up Fable: TLC (Game Data) - - ✅ - - Step 1 ---------- Find where your game's "File Directory" is located on your computer's Hard Drive. In other words, find where exactly the game was installed to! Where you have to look for the files in this step, will actually depend on which version of the game that you are currently using on your PC. These are the default file paths for each version: CD Version: C:\Program Files\Microsoft Games Steam Version: C:\Program Files (x86)\Steam\steamapps\common Step 2 ---------- Now you can copy the entire "Fable The Lost Chapters" folder that is located here and paste it somewhere else on your computer or Hard Drive. This can be done by right clicking the folder and then pressing copy. Once you have done that, you can create a New Folder somewhere else on your computer and then paste the game files in there. Step 3 ----------- Whenever you run into any issue or your game crashes because of modding it, just delete the version of the game that you are currently playing with and paste in this new "Backup Version" which you have just created. Congratulations, you have learned how to make a backup of your Game Data! - ✅ - - How To Back-up Fable: TLC (Save Data) - - ✅ - - Step 1 ---------- Find where your game's "Save File Directory" is located on your computer's Hard Drive, which is pretty much the same for everyone, regardless of what version of the game that you are using! Save File Directory: C:\Users\Capri\Documents\My Games Step 2 ---------- Now you can copy the entire "Fable" folder that is located here and paste it somewhere else on your computer. This process is pretty much the same as "Step 2" for backing up your Game Data, however, you might want to keep both of these New Folders separated. Congratulations, you have learned how to make a backup of your Save Data! - 🛠 - - Notes - - 🛠 - - 1 ) You CAN just copy the "Data" folder that is found inside of your game's File Directory in a lot of cases. That being said, there are some mods which are known to change files that are located outside of the data folder. In my opinion, it is best to copy the entire game folder... just to be sure! 2 ) If you aren't aware, the "Steam Version" of Fable: TLC does not actually have DRM (Digital Rights Management). This means that it is possible for you to copy the Game Data from its default File Directory and still play that "Copied" version of the game.
